Formula Used
The cost of living index is calculated using the following formula:
Where:
- Your Monthly Expenses - The sum of all your monthly expenses
- National Average Monthly Expenses - The average monthly expenses for your location
A Cost of Living Index above 100 means your expenses are higher than the national average, while an index below 100 means your expenses are lower.
